Porcelain stoneware slabs
Product information
Porcelain stoneware is a special type of ceramic product, used for floors and walls, combining the highest levels of technical features to a particularly prestigious appearance.
The areas of application in the building industry are multiple, these slabs can be used for internal and external walls and floorings.
The products satisfy the technical specifications defined by the European standard EN 14411 and International ISO 13006, according to criteria established by method ISO 10545 - International Organization for Standardization Specifications for Ceramic Tile.
The slab, regardless of the thickness, is mainly composed of mineral raw materials (clay, quartz, kaolin, feldspar) that come partly directly from quarries and partly from recycled material, the latter mainly coming from pre-consumer material and from ceramic waste coming from other factories of the ceramic and sanitary sectors. The aesthetic appearance of porcelain stoneware slab is obtained mainly in the phase of preparation of the mixture by application of appropriate amounts of colorant agents in variable amounts.
